My Fitness Journey: Learning to Move Again with XFyt

If you had told me a few years ago that I would voluntarily wake up and head to the gym several times a week, I would have laughed.

For most of my life, fitness wasn’t something I actively thought about. I was always on the leaner side. I had my curves, but I never crossed the 45 kg mark before becoming a mom. I never counted calories, never followed strict workout plans, and certainly never spent hours researching weight loss techniques.

My idea of healthy living was much simpler.

I would Google superfoods for glowing skin, then Google recipes to include them in my daily meals. I loved experimenting with healthy ingredients, but I also enjoyed eating whatever I wanted without much guilt. My weight remained stable, my energy levels were good, and fitness was never something I felt I needed to prioritize.

Then life happened.

Motherhood changed many things, but surprisingly, weight gain wasn’t one of them. In fact, I didn’t start gaining weight immediately after childbirth like many people expect.

The real change happened almost three years later.

After battling COVID and then dealing with a severe allergic reaction shortly afterwards, my body started responding differently. The weight began creeping up steadily and stubbornly.

45 kg became 50 kg.

50 kg became 55 kg.

55 kg became 58 kg.

And before I knew it, I was staring at a number close to 60 kg.

At first, I tried the things that had always worked before. I cut back on carbs. I walked a little more. I tried being more mindful about my meals.

Nothing seemed to make much of a difference.

That was the moment I realized I needed to do more than just tweak my diet. I needed to actively work on my fitness.

So, I joined a gym.

The first few days were not glamorous.

Every muscle in my body hurt. Climbing stairs felt like punishment. Getting out of bed became an achievement in itself. Yet somehow, I kept showing up. Day after day, I dragged my sore body back to the gym and slowly started building a routine.
